Step into a world of nostalgic wonder with this exquisite vintage Bing & Grøndahl porcelain figurine, model #1721, affectionately known as "Mary - Girl with Doll." Crafted in the heart of Denmark during the golden era of mid-20th-century artistry (circa 1952-1957), this delicate masterpiece stands at about 7.5 inches tall, a testament to the unparalleled skill of designer Ingeborg Plockross Irminger. In excellent vintage condition, this first-quality piece bears the authentic green factory mark on the base, including the iconic three towers, confirming its Danish origin and era. Light surface dust from years of gentle display adds to its authentic patina, easily refreshed with a soft cloth, but no damage mars its beauty—no chips, no cracks, no restorations.
